Removing AC engine bracket from a 3.2
Can anyone give me some advice on the removal of the AC compressor bracket that is mounted to the engine to the right of the fan?
I tried removing the bottom bolt underneath and the other bolt near the fuel injectors but the thing won't budge. Actually, I can get it to budge about a mm if I use a hammer. Is this bracket only removable with the engine out of the car? Mahalo in advance! Mele Kalikimaka!! |
